Located within Shenzhen Mission Hills Resort, this 8,500㎡ boutique hotel features 48 rooms and suites, all-day dining, SPA and infinity pool. "Concealment" is the core concept — the building lies low at the foot of the mountain, with stepped terraces bringing lake views into every room.
Interior design centers on "emptiness" and "stillness," using natural stone, bamboo-wood, and fair-faced concrete. Spatial layout emphasizes the rhythm of "conceal" and "reveal" — a deliberately low and narrow entrance suddenly opens to panoramic lake views.
The building steps back with the mountain slope, ensuring all 48 rooms have unobstructed lake views. Each room features a private terrace or courtyard of 15-30㎡. The stepping design reduces visual mass on the natural landscape.
Exterior walls combine local stone veneer with fair-faced concrete, with stone recycled from foundation excavation. Bamboo-wood composites reduce raw wood consumption by 60%. Natural textures and color variations of all materials are carefully preserved.
The infinity pool cantilevering over the lake is the hotel's visual focal point. The 35-meter pool edge uses transparent acrylic panels, creating the sensation of floating on water. Post-tensioned concrete beams achieve a 10-meter cantilever.
Landscape design integrates the building into existing vegetation, preserving 17 century-old trees. Building footprint occupies only 12% of the site. Natural terrain drainage achieves zero stormwater runoff. Firefly populations returned in the second year after opening.
The hotel scored 4.9 on Ctrip after opening and was named one of China's Best New Hotels by Condé Nast Traveler. Most frequent guest feedback keywords: "quiet," "immersed in nature," "meticulous details." Average stay of 2.8 nights, 0.5 nights above regional average, with 35% return rate.
